Montavion

A modern invented name using the popular '-avion' suffix (evoking 'aviation' and movement), Montavion combines mountain imagery with a sense of flight and modernity. This name epitomizes contemporary American naming trends that stack multiple elements for maximum uniqueness.

Part of the contemporary American trend of creating names with '-avion' or '-tion' suffixes, popular particularly in African-American communities.
